The school nurse is talking with a group of parents about the growth and development of their school-aged children. A parent asks the nurse, "Just what are growing pains?" Which of the following is the best response?
a. "The bones hurt when calcium builds up and the bones are stretching out in length."
b. "When the long bones are growing faster than the attached muscle, pain can occur."
c. "The nerves are chemically irritated when the bones are elongating in growth."
d. "As the bones get longer, the skin has to grow and stretch and this hurts."
B
Feedback
A Incorrect: Growing pains are not the result of calcium building up or the bones are stretching out in length.
B Correct: Growing pains are the result of the long bones growing faster than the attached muscles.
C Incorrect: Growing pains are not the result of the nerves being irritated
D Incorrect: Growing pains are not related to the stretching of skin.
